William Strang

1859 – 1921

The Fisherman by William Strang
 

The Fisherman   1908

  Original drypoint.
Signed in pencil.
Ref: Binyon 497; David Strang 608 iv/iv
S 329 x 254 mm; P 288 x 239 mm; I 230 mm diameter.
SOLD
 
Rich impression with strong, fresh drypoint burr. One of only about 30 signed proof impressions printed from the completed plate.

A particularly beautiful impression of this unusual allegorical work. The Fisherman presents one of the finest of William Strang’s classical nude groups and demonstrates clearly the artist’s outstanding ability with the drypoint needle. It is an exceptionally decorative composition for the often severe and uncompromising William Strang.

On fine simile-Japan paper with full margins. One or two expert repairs to reverse of sheet, otherwise very fine condition.
